Ordinals
beta
Sat 695934848423642
decimal
139186.4848423642
degree
0°139186′82″4848423642‴
percentile
33.13975472329384%
name
ixonzzqpekt
cycle
0
epoch
0
period
69
block
139186
offset
4848423642
timestamp
2011-08-01 20:29:36 UTC
rarity
common
prev
next